Understanding Off-Road Track Systems

Off-road track systems are an important component for vehicles that need to navigate through challenging terrains such as mud, snow, and sand. The tracks provide better traction and floatation by distributing the vehicle’s weight over a larger surface area, reducing the possibility of getting stuck. Customizing track systems for specific off-road terrains can significantly enhance a vehicle’s performance and reliability.

Choosing the Right Track System

When customizing track systems for off-road use, it’s essential to choose the right type of track based on the terrain. For rocky and uneven surfaces, heavier-duty metal tracks are necessary to withstand the harsh conditions. On the other hand, for softer terrains like snow or mud, rubber or composite tracks with deeper treads are more suitable, providing better traction and minimizing slippage.

Adjusting Track Width and Length

Another crucial aspect of customizing track systems for specific terrains is adjusting the width and length of the tracks. Wider tracks distribute the vehicle’s weight more evenly, reducing ground pressure and preventing sinkage in soft terrains. Longer tracks also provide better flotation and traction, especially in deep snow or mud. By modifying the track width and length, vehicles can navigate through different terrains with greater ease and stability.

Optimizing Suspension and Drive Systems

Customizing track systems also involves optimizing the suspension and drive systems of the vehicle. Upgraded suspension components can accommodate the added weight and different dynamics of track systems, ensuring a smoother ride over rough terrains. Additionally, adjustments to the drive systems may be necessary to maintain optimal power delivery to the tracks, enhancing traction and maneuverability in challenging conditions.

Utilizing Advanced Track Materials and Design

Advancements in track materials and design have led to improved performance and durability in off-road applications. Cutting-edge composite materials offer enhanced strength and flexibility, contributing to better track longevity and resistance to damage. Innovative track designs with self-cleaning treads and optimized contact patches further improve traction and reduce the accumulation of mud, snow, or debris.
